With VDC

Yaw Rate & Lateral G Sensor

REMOVAL
1) Disconnect the ground cable from the battery.





2) Remove the console box.
3) Disconnect the connector from yaw rate & lateral G sensor.
4) Remove the yaw rate & lateral G sensor.

CAUTION:
^ Do not drop or bump the yaw rate & lateral G sensor.
^ The sensor and bracket is considered a single part. Do not disassemble.






INSTALLATION
Install in the reverse order of removal.

CAUTION: Do not install the yaw rate & lateral G sensors facing an incorrect direction. There is an arrow mark on the sensor showing the front direction of the vehicle.





Tightening torque: 18 N-m (1.8 kgf-m, 13.3 ft-lb)

CAUTION:
^ Do not drop or bump the yaw rate & lateral G sensor. After installation, always make the following two settings.
^ Steering angle sensor centering setting
^ Yaw rate & lateral G sensor 0 point setting
^ These two procedures are required to make the VDCCM recognize what position the vehicle is in later. Refer to VDCCM Adjustments for procedures regarding the above settings.
